2. DO Calibration in % Saturation Mode (with
ATC)
2.1 About DO(%) and DO (mg/L) Calibration
The calibration of % Saturation of DO will linearly affect the measurement
for DO in mg/L. The amount of oxygen dissolved in water will depend on its
temperature, atmospheric pressure and its salinity. It is therefore very
important that the temperature is calibrated if necessary prior to the DO
calibration.
Hence calibration in % Saturation of DO should be carried out first. This is
described in the following section.
The 600 series meters can be calibrated quickly and easily in air. In %
Saturation, the meter is able to perform either a one point calibration or a 2
point calibration. For one point calibration, it is recommended that you
perform a 100% Saturation calibration in saturated air. If you opt for 2 point
calibration, you can calibrate for 100% Saturation in saturated air and 0%
Saturation using a zero oxygen solution.
The meters are capable of measuring barometric pressure with its built-in
pressure sensor. In the event, the pressure reading is inaccurate, you can
calibrate the value from the setup menu.
2.2 To calibrate 100% saturation
1. Switch the meter on and make sure the meter is in % saturation mode.
2. Hold the probe in the air gently with the sensor facing down and press
CAL (F2) to start calibration.
3. The meter shows the ‘Dissolved O
2
Calibration-Rinse Electrode’ screen
for a few seconds to prompt user to rinse electrode with de-ionized
water before calibration.
Note: If the meter is password protected, you will be prompted to enter a
password.
